Output e64a73104b8e297d582ce0dd49e7f71d24505fcf8e6f901bdd562a5536646b7a:0

value
32052637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ee05f251bf9b302fd4a1f57f1ade85eb4b9bc17 OP_EQUAL
address
3PU5XpG3hSAqnH7HW8Cnrrd5EQom6mqa8h
transaction
e64a73104b8e297d582ce0dd49e7f71d24505fcf8e6f901bdd562a5536646b7a
spent
true